Objective: This study aims to evaluate the clinical outcomes of Vancouver B1 periprosthetic femoral fractures (PFF) treated with the Ortho-bridge system (OBS) internal fixation and assess the potential benefits of 3D printing technology in preoperative planning and surgical execution for these cases.

Method: This retrospective study analyzed 55 consecutive Vancouver B1 periprosthetic femoral fracture cases treated surgically at Yan'an Affiliated Hospital of Kunming Medical University (2014-2022) with minimum 1-year follow-up. Patients were divided into conventional ORIF (n = 21) and OBS fixation groups (n = 34), with the OBS group further stratified into standard procedure (n = 18) and 3D-printing-assisted (n = 16) subgroups.

  • Plantar fascia (PF) is a common cause of foot pain for adults, and several surgical treatments exist for it.
  • A study involving 60 patients evaluated the effectiveness of three treatments: Needle Knife Therapy, Endoscopic Plantar Fasciotomy, and Conventional Painkillers, using VAS and AOFAS scores for analysis.
  • The results showed that Endoscopic Plantar Fasciotomy led to significantly lower pain scores compared to the other treatments, indicating it may be the most effective option for long-term pain relief and functional improvement.

Objective: To compare and analyze the Ortho-Bridge System (OBS) clinical efficacy assisted by 3D printing and proximal femoral nail anti-rotation (PFNA) of AO/OTA type 31-A3 femoral intertrochanteric fractures in elderly patients.

Methods: A retrospective analysis of 25 elderly patients diagnosed with AO/OTA type 31-A3 femoral intertrochanteric fracture was conducted from January 2020 to August 2022 at Yan'an Hospital, affiliated to Kunming Medical University. The patients were divided into 10 patients in the OBS group and 15 in the PFNA group according to different surgical methods.
